Yes! Most hotel reservations are refundable provided that you cancel prior to the accommodation's cancellation deadline, which often is within 24-48 hours of your scheduled arrival. If your reservation is non-refundable, it may still be possible to cancel it and be given a refund within a 24-hour period of booking. Add dates, click "Search", then use the "fully refundable" filter to view the top deals on offer near Yil Cumhuriyet Stadium.